MENARD v. FERGUSON

No. 36017.

60 Wn.2d 59 (1962)

371 P.2d 629

RICHARD J. MENARD, Respondent, v. EDITH FERGUSON et al., Appellants.

The Supreme Court of Washington, Department One.

May 22, 1962.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Lycette, Diamond & Sylvester, and Martin L. Wolf, for appellants.

Richard C. Shanks, for respondent.


FOSTER, J.

Appellants, defendants below,1 in an automobile collision case, appeal from a judgment on the verdict in favor of respondent, plaintiff below.

The mishap occurred at approximately four-thirty on a mid-December afternoon as respondent was emerging from a private driveway onto an arterial street. Three hundred feet to his left, appellant's car was stopped at a street intersection...
